Setauket Green I
Setauket Presbyterian (1812). The burial yard dates from the 1660s.
Setauket (Long Island) was a part of early Colonial Connecticut. Setauket was initially referred to as Ashford in the early Connecticut General Court's records.
The Green is a good example of a path branching signature with terminus. The branch to the left goes down to a ford site over what is now the Mill Pond that leads out to Old Field point. The right branch joins a path leading to Little Bay and on to Port Jefferson Harbor.
